This was one of my first builds for the DLC, and I have to say that it's pretty amazing, and definitely a build I'd recommend to anyone who wants to get into PvP.
The 45 Dexterity allows for the fastest cast time which catches even the best players off-guard and makes them uncomfortable with your Dark Bead spell.
The build's damage output is devastating, whether you chip away at your opponent for 300 - 500 damage per hit with your buffed Side Sword quickly decimating any low-poise build, or using Pursuers and Dark Bead works as heavy alterity against players with more poise, you're not going to have a hard time with even the most experienced players. However, the mastering simultaneous use will definitely make you a force to be reckoned for builds of any level.
The armor set-up is quite simple. It's light, and gives you 56 poise allowing you to take even the Greatswords running attack without flinching. The Gauntlet of Thorns also serves the additional purpose of dealing phantom damage preventing people from backstab you while you're rolling. This feature is invaluable while fighting gankers or backstab-fishers.
The low Endurance is no issue at all considering the weapon this build is using and the Stamina boost from the RoFAP, which also proves that if you can manage your stamina properly you don't need obsessive amounts of Endurance.
When low on spells you might want to switch out the Tin Crystallization Catalyst for either the Sorcerer's Catalyst / Beatrice's Catalyst / Izalith Catalyst, that way you can get an additional casting of Pursuers and Crystal Magic Weapon each.
This build works just as well for invasions as it does in the arena, as the general strategy in the latter is to get around 3 kills before dying and recharging its spells, although it could last for the entire 3 minute fight since you'll get up to 2 CMW which can be augmented with Charcole / Pine Resin.
